## Break-Glass: Coinloom Rounding Fix

Quick note for the eng sync: the Coinloom currency-conversion service is dropping fractional cents again, and reconciliation in Marbury is off by a few dollars a day. If it happens mid-release, you can break-glass into the pricing config to force the banker's-rounding flag — just ping finance first and log it. The break-glass console accepts the recovery passphrase below.

vault phrase of tajop-haduf = holath-brivan-wenax

## Turnstile Upgrade — Brandell Quay Lobby

New Orvix turnstiles go live Monday. Old tap cards stop working at 09:00. Direct anyone without a new badge to the accessibility gate beside the reception counter. Reception staff can release that gate manually; the override panel under the desk requires the code below.

door code, yagap-bahof: bdg-O-05

Ticket OV-412: Charset sniffer plugin can't reach metadata DB. Since the Glyphon 2.3 upload service moved to the new VPC, plugin workers detecting file encodings fail with connection timeouts when writing detection results. Affects all external plugins using the metadata writer API. Workaround: retry with backoff is NOT sufficient; use the updated endpoint. Plugin authors should reconnect using the string below.

replica DSN, kajep-yahag: mssql://praok_svc:iF@db-8d68.plorvaio.local:5432/eliion